4. B modeling#
4.1. Characteristics of modeling#
We use 3D volume modeling for concrete and a grid_membrane model for reinforcements whose support meshes are quadrangles with four nodes.
4.2. Characteristics of the mesh#

Number of knots: 8
Number of meshes:
1 hexa8 mesh for concrete
1 quad4 mesh for the reinforcement layers (N05-N02-N03-N08)
Two grid_membrane models are defined for the reinforcements (one in direction \(X\), one in direction \(Y\))
